BAKED PARMESAN CHICKEN 
2 1/2 to 3 lbs. chicken, skin removed
1 1/2 c. seasoned bread crumbs
1/2 to 3/4 c. grated Parmesan cheese
1 clove garlic, chopped fine or 1 tsp. extract
1/2 c. melted butter

If you use unseasoned bread crumbs, add about 1 teaspoon salt.

Mix the crumbs (Italian seasoned bread crumbs, especially good), the Parmesan, and garlic. Dip each piece of chicken in the melted butter and then in the crumb mixture.

Arrange in a shallow baking pan. Cover and bake about 1 hour at 350 degrees, uncover and bake another 1/2 hour. Baste often with melted butter or pan drippings.

OPTIONAL: Rather than dipping chicken in butter, can be dipped in milk-egg mixture before coating with the crumbs. Then place in pan, drizzle lightly with melted butter and bake as instructed.
